1. After around 1 week the glue starts to feel slidy around my head. I am assuming its becsuse it is a thinner base. Does this happen to you?

2. When aplying the system, it always wants to fold back on itself. Any top tips to help combat this would be appreciated.

3. I have noticed the hairline moving back past the front layer of thinskin. Is this normal? I have been wearing for 5 months and dont expose it so not a major problem.

1. Not after a week, maybe after 10 - 14 days for me. But I only use a single layer of glue because I prefer shorter de/re times and regular cleanups. Maybe you sweat more, or maybe the glue isn't ideal? Try Ghost Bond variants - they work well for me. Also make sure you don't do any serious activity like running etc for 24 hours after bonding.

2. I don't usually have this problem but you could try rolling on the system rather than laying it flat (if that makes sense).

3. Hairs will shed... and certainly for me at least, they shed more at the hairline because I expose fully and hence tinker/re-glue/comb more at the hairline. Buy yourself some small nail scissors and snip the excess skin off, i.e. where the hairs have shed. I start doing this usually at the 3 or 4 month mark. At the 5th month I replace the system because too much hair has shed, or it has become brittle, or the colour has faded etc. The longer you try and make your old system last, the more of a shock it will be when you get a new system, because it will look so different.

In my experience, UTS looks great for 2 months but then begins a slow death that takes it to 6 months. Ideal time to replace (for me) would be 3 months, but to save on costs I stretch to 5 months, with regular maintenance and care.

FYI, these systems are normally sold as 1-2 month systems. So you should plan accordingly.

While it's great to get longevity from a system the goal is to have a consistent look. If you want more, then go for a 0.06 mm STS.
